摘要

目的:分析急性心肌梗死(AMI)患者在接受经皮冠状动脉介入治疗(PCI)后,外周血内皮细胞来源的微粒中的microRNA-126(miR-126)表达水平以及单核细胞与高密度脂蛋白胆固醇比值(MHR)的变化及其临床意义.方法:纳入2019-2022年在新疆维吾尔自治区人民医院心内科进行冠状动脉造影(CAG),随后确诊为AMI并接受PCI治疗的60例患者(AMI组).同时,纳入60例慢性冠状动脉疾病(CCD)患者(CCD组)以及60例健康个体(健康组)作为对照.测定并对比各组患者外周血内皮微粒中的miR-126和MHR表达水平,并计算Gensini评分.相关性分析采用Spearman检验,AMI发生的危险因素采用logistic回归分析,各指标的诊断价值采用ROC曲线分析.结果:AMI组miR-126水平低于CCD组及对照组,MHR高于CCD组及对照组.Spearman相关性分析结果表明,miR-126的表达水平与Gensini评分呈负相关性(r=-0.460,P<0.001),MHR与 Gensini 评分呈正相关性(r=0.468,P<0.001).多因素 logistic 回归分析显示,miR-126(OR=6.995,95%CI:2.126~23.018,P=0.001)、MHR(OR=4.527,95%CI:1.145~17.895,P<0.031)和 Gensini 评分(OR=0.949,95%CI:0.925~0.974,P<0.001)是AMI发生的独立危险因素.ROC曲线分析表明,miR-126、MHR和Gensini评分联合检测预测AMI的曲线下面积(AUC)为0.894(95%CI:0.951~0.836,P<0.001),特异度为95%,灵敏度为76.7%,高于各指标单独预测.结论:miR-126水平和MHR与AMI的发生及冠心病严重程度有重要联系,是潜在的预测和诊断AMI的生物标记物.

Abstract

Objective:To analyze the expression levels of microRNA-126(miR-126)in endothelial cell-derived microparticles in peripheral blood and the changes in the ratio of monocyte to high-density lipoprotein cholesterol(MHR)in patients with acute myocardial infarction(AMI)after undergoing percutaneous coronary intervention(PCI),as well as their clinical significance.Methods:Sixty patients who underwent coronary angiography(CAG)and were subsequently diagnosed with AMI,then received PCI treatment at the Department of Cardiology,People's Hospital of Xinjiang Uygur Autonomous Region from 2019 to 2022 were included(AMI group).Addi-tionally,60 patients with chronic coronary disease(CCD)were included in the CCD group,60 healthy individuals were included in the health group.The expression levels of miR-126 in peripheral blood endothelial microparticles,the MHR,and Gensini scores among each group were measured and compared.The correlation analysis was con-ducted using Spearman test,the risk factors for AMI were analyzed using logistic regression,and the diagnostic value of each indicator was analyzed using ROC curve.Results:The miR-126 levels in the AMI group were lower than those in the CCD and control groups,while the MHR was higher than those in the CCD and NC groups.The Spearman correlation analysis indicated that the miR-126 levels was negatively correlated with Gensini scores(r=-0.460,P<0.001),while MHR was positively correlated with Gensini score(r=0.468,P<0.001).Multiva-riate logistic regression analysis showed that miR-126(OR=6.995,95%CI:2.126-23.018,P=0.001),MHR(OR=4.527,95%CI:1.145-17.895,P<0.031),and Gensini score(OR=0.949,95%CI:0.925-0.974,P<0.001)were independent risk factors for the occurrence of AMI.ROC curve analysis indicated that the area under the curve(AUC)of miR-126,MHR,and Gensini score combined detection for predicting AMI was 0.894(95%CI:0.951-0.836,P<0.001),with a specificity of 95%and a sensitivity of 76.7%,which was higher than the prediction of each indicator separately.Conclusion:The levels of miR-126 and MHR are significantly as-sociated with the occurrence and severity of coronary heart disease,and they are potential biomarkers for diagno-sing and predicting AMI.
